Nicaraguan · serves 4 · about 25 minutes
Nicaragua's painted rooster — day-old rice fried into small red beans until every grain is speckled. Across the border they make it with black beans and claim they invented it. They are wrong, says Managua.
Ingredients
- 3 cups Iberia Parboiled Rice 5 lbs
- 2 cups Iberia Small Red Beans W/S 15 oz
- 1/2 white onion, minced
- 1/2 red pepper, minced
- 3 tbsp Iberia Baby Eels In Olive Oil 4 oz
- to taste salt
Method
- Heat the oil in a wide pan until it shimmers; soften the onion and pepper.
- Add the beans and fry 3-4 minutes, letting some blister and pop.
- Add the rice and a few spoonfuls of bean broth; fry, folding, until the rice is stained red-brown — pinto, painted.
- Press flat and let the bottom crisp one minute. Fold once more.
- Serve with eggs, crema, maduro, or all three. In Nicaragua this is breakfast, lunch, and an argument-winner.
